Contemporary Composite Decking

modern synthetic decking material

Contemporary composite decking combines style and durability for your outdoor space.

Enjoy a sleek deck that withstands the elements while providing the natural wood feel without the hassle.

Here are four key reasons to consider contemporary composite decking:

  1. Minimal Maintenance: No sanding or staining needed—just an occasional wash keeps it looking great!
  2. Eco-Friendly: Made from recycled materials, it's a sustainable choice that contributes to a greener planet.
  3. Variety of Colors: Choose from a wide range of styles and colors to reflect your taste and complement your home.
  4. Safety First: Composite decking is splinter-free, ensuring safety for both children and pets.

Eco-Friendly Deck Options

sustainable outdoor flooring choices

As you plan your deck, consider eco-friendly options that showcase your commitment to sustainability while enhancing your outdoor space. Choosing green materials doesn't mean compromising on style or comfort; in fact, they can offer a distinctive look.

Here's a quick comparison of popular eco-friendly decking materials:

Material Benefits
Composite Wood Made from recycled materials; low maintenance
Bamboo Fast-growing, renewable, and stylish
Reclaimed Wood Unique character; conserves trees
PVC Decking Durable; often made from recycled plastics

These options contribute to a healthier planet while adding character to your home. Picture lounging on a stylish bamboo deck or hosting friends on a reclaimed wood deck that has its own story. Plus, eco-friendly choices can reduce maintenance costs. Ready to build a deck that makes Mother Nature proud?

What Materials Are Best for Durable Backyard Decks?

When it comes to building a durable backyard deck, you can't go wrong with materials like composite, hardwood, or pressure-treated wood.

Composite's resistant to splintering and fading, making it a low-maintenance champ, while hardwoods like teak or mahogany offer stunning beauty and longevity.

Pressure-treated wood, budget-friendly and sturdy, can also withstand the elements if you're willing to maintain it.

Are There Building Codes or Permits Required for Decks?

You might be wondering about building codes and permits for your new deck.

Well, they're often a must! You'll want to check with your local authority to see what's required. Different areas have different rules, so visiting the website or giving them a call can help avoid any surprises.

Plus, getting the right permits guarantees your deck's safe and sound—no one wants it tumbling down during a barbecue, right?
